Web14 de abr. de 2024 · Step 1: Press the Windows + S keys, type Snipping Tool in the search box, and then hit Enter on the keyboard. Step 2: You can change the shape of your snip by choosing Rectangular mode (by default), Window mode, Full-screen mode, and Free-form mode. Step 3: Click New to take a screenshot on Windows 11. WebHow to Access Files on iPhone from a Windows 10 PC 1. Unlock iPhone. Your phone must be unlocked before you connect it to your Windows 10 system. If it is locked, the files won’t load even if you routinely connect the device to the same system. Disconnect the iPhone from your system.
